Anima: Gate of Memories I&II is an attempt to revive a franchise that wasn’t well received at the time, but became some sort of cult classic, likely thanks to its fanbase. I have to say that I understand why both of these outcomes occurred, as it is a game with a very interesting world and story, charismatic characters and strong art direction and soundtrack. However, it still suffers from clunky controls, overwhelming bosses and unbalanced gameplay at times, despite this being a re-release.

Anima Gate of Memories: I&II Remaster is a collection that deserves credit for re-releasing two unique titles in the most solid and consistent way possible. It does not attempt to modernize the formula or reinvent it, but aims to provide a more stable experience that is less prone to the original technical issues. The two narrative perspectives contained in a single package emerge today with greater clarity and continuity, representing the true added value of this new edition. It is a recommended collection for those who have never played the series, and a useful opportunity for those who wanted to replay it without the limitations of the past.

Anima: Gate of Memories I & II Remaster delivered an improved version with superior lighting, textures, and new difficulty settings. However, it still falls short due to the lack of Portuguese subtitles and the limiting Ki bar, which hinders the overall combat flow.

Anima: Gate of Memories is decent, and I did enjoy my time with it overall. But the repetitive combat and clunky mechanics hold it back from being truly fun. I do think though that most people who decide to pick it up will enjoy it especially for the current price. The story is interesting, the world is varied, the graphics overhaul is well done, but with the remaster you aren’t getting much new content just a collection with a face lift.
